Flu Clinics

We will be holding a flu clinic on the mornings of Saturday 18th September and Saturday 16th October. These will be bookable appointments only (NO walk-in appointments) please phone the surgery after 2pm any day except Monday to book an appointment. We are prioritising our patient’s aged 65 and older and those in a clinical at risk group. If you are a healthy 50-64 year old you are able to have a flu vaccine but we will not be setting up clinics until later in the year and have had our full delivery of vaccines arrive in the surgery. You can book a vaccine at a pharmacy.

Blood bottle shortage

There is an ongoing national shortage of blood bottles and as advised by the government we are having to cancel routine tests. Please see the alert at the top of our website page.

Demand

We are experiencing a huge surge in demand for appointments (around 20% higher than before the pandemic) please consider self-help for basic ailments (cuts, grazes and tummy upsets) Pharmacies for advice on ailments and medication. 111 – When the surgery is closed and you need medical help fast, but it is not a life threatening situation or you need to go to A&E. 999 – for a life threatening situation. We apologise if you are having to wait a little longer for your phone call to be answered, please be patient and polite to our reception team who are working very hard to keep up with demand.
